What is Scale Length?
Scale length refers to the distance between the nut and the saddle on a guitar, typically measured in inches or millimeters. It determines the placement of frets and the tension of the strings, ultimately influencing the instrument’s playability and tone.

Why Does Scale Length Matter?
Scale length directly impacts the tension and pitch of the strings. A longer scale length generally results in higher string tension and brighter tone, while a shorter scale length tends to produce lower string tension and warmer tones. Additionally, scale length affects intonation, fret spacing, and overall feel of the guitar.
